About this settlement

Settlement for consumers who bought certain G.Skill desktop memory products with alleged deceptive advertising about product speeds.

This class action settlement addresses deceptive advertising claims related to G.Skill DDR-4 and DDR-5 desktop memory products sold with rated speeds over 2133 MHz or 4800 MHz respectively. Eligible consumers who purchased these products between January 31, 2018 and January 7, 2026 may file claims for compensation.

Who qualifies

  • Consumers who purchased one or more G.Skill DDR-4 or DDR-5 desktop memory products with rated speeds over 2133 MHz or 4800 MHz respectively.
  • Purchases made between January 31, 2018 and January 7, 2026.
  • Claims for more than five products require proof of purchase.
